Beecher's Kale And Brown Rice Gratin With Smoked Cheese

Total Time: 2 hrs Preparation Time: 20 mins Cook Time: 1 hr 40 mins

Ingredients

  • Servings: 6
  • 2 cups chicken broth
  • 1 cup brown rice
  • 1 tablespoon extra virgin olive oil
  • 1 big sweet onion, cut in half then into thin slices
  • 4 garlic cloves, minced
  • 4 cups kale or 1/2 bunch kale, chopped packed
  • salt, to taste
  • pepper, to taste
  • 1 tablespoon butter
  • 2 tablespoons flour
  • 1 1/2 cups milk
  • 3/4 cup fontina cheese, shredded divided
  • 3/4 cup smoked gouda cheese, shredded divided

Recipe

  • 1 bring chicken broth to a boil in a small saucepan then add rice.
  • 2 cover then turn heat down to medium-low and cook until rice is tender, 35-40 minutes.
  • 3 remove from heat then set aside with the lid on for 10 minutes.
  • 4 meanwhile heat olive oil in a large, non-,stick skillet over medium heat then add onions and a dash of salt.
  • 5 stir to coat then cook, stirring occasionally, until onions are golden brown and very tender, 25-30 minutes.
  • 6 add garlic and kale, season with salt and pepper, and then cook until kale is tender, 3-4 minutes.
  • 7 scoop mixture into a large bowl then set aside.
  • 8 in the same skillet melt butter then sprinkle in flour and whisk to incorporate.
  • 9 cook for 30 seconds then slowly pour in milk while whisking constantly to avoid lumps.
  • 10 season with salt and pepper then turn heat up slightly to bring to a bubble and then turn heat back down to medium and cook until thickened and bubbly, stirring often, 5-6 minutes.
  • 11 remove from heat then gradually stir in 1/2 cup of each cheese until melted and smooth.
  • 12 preheat oven to 375 degrees then spray a 9×12′ or 8×8′ baking dish very well with nonstick spray.
  • 13 add cooked rice and cheese sauce to kale mixture in the bowl then mix to combine. pour mixture into prepared baking dish then sprinkle with remaining cheese.
  • 14 bake for 25-30 minutes or until dark golden brown on top.
  • 15 let sit for 10-15 minutes (or longer!) before serving.
